There may be a wealth of options available for patients with heart failure but work is continually being done to find new and better treatment options.

Paul W. Armstrong, MD, from the University of Alberta discussed a new potential treatment working its way through the trial process which could help doctors provide a better quality of life for their patients during the American Heart Association's annal meeting in Orlando.
